PRU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review

1,001 of the 4,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Prudential Financial (PRU)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$24.4B — up 13% from $21.6B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 103 funds opened new PRU positions and 66 closed out — a net gain of 37 holders — while 393 added to existing stakes and 340 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$167M. The largest seller was Massachusetts Financial Services, cutting an estimated $185M.
